1Intervention ArmProcedure-karNapUraNam, कर्णपूरणम् (Procedure Reference: Yogaratnakar, Procedure details: Patient is Advised to lie down on a a table in right or left lateral position. The area around the ear is massaged with luke warm oil for 5 minutes till the oil gets absorbed. Give hot fomentation with hot water bag untill the area becomes little erythematous then lukewarm Hingvadi Taila is poured into the patient ear canal upto filling of external auditory canal in each ear(2-2.5ml) for 100 Matrakala (Approx 2.5-3Minutes) once a day in evening(sayankala) 3 sittings of 8 days with 3 days gap bet)
(1) Medicine Name: Hingvadi Taila, Reference: Gada Nigrah, Route: Otic, Dosage Form: Taila, Dose: 5(ml), Frequency: od, Duration: 30 Days
(2) Medicine Name: Ashwagandha Ghrita, Reference: Chakartdatta, Route: Oral, Dosage Form: Ghrita, Dose: 10(g), Frequency: bd, Duration: 30 Days
2Comparator ArmProcedure-karNapUraNam, कर्णपूरणम् (Procedure Reference: Yogaratnakar, Procedure details: Patient is Advised to lie down on a a table in right or left lateral position. The area around the ear is massaged with luke warm oil for 5 minutes till the oil gets absorbed. Give hot fomentation with hot water bag untill the area becomes little erythematous then lukewarm Nirgundyadi Taila is poured into the patient ear canal upto filling of external auditory canal in each ear(2-2.5ml) for 100 Matrakala (Approx 2.5-3Minutes) once a day in evening(sayankala) 3 sittings of 8 days with 3 days gap )
(1) Medicine Name: Nirgundyadi Taila, Reference: Yogaratnakar, Route: Otic, Dosage Form: Taila, Dose: 5(ml), Frequency: od, Duration: 30 Days
(2) Medicine Name: Ashwagandha Ghrita, Reference: Chakardatta, Route: Oral, Dosage Form: Ghrita, Dose: 10(g), Frequency: bd, Duration: 30 Days

Brief Summary  
Tinnitus is a common problem for millions of people, as epidemiological studies have reported its prevalence to be between 8 to 25.3% of the population of the United States.Similarly, population based studies conducted in other nations have found a similar prevalence of Tinnitus, ranging from 4.6% to 30%.Tinnitus is a common and debilitating disorder in India with a prevalence of more than 7% of the Indian population.It severely affects the quality of life of around 1-3% of the world.Tinnitus affects 10 to 15 % of adult general population. About 20 % of Tinnitus population requires serious clinical .The 7th – 13th of February 2022 brings us Tinnitus Awareness Week Recognized each year throughout the world in the first full week of February, the purpose of this week is to educate the public about the symptoms of tinnitus and how it affects people.The prevalence of tinnitus increases to 70-85% in the hearing-impaired population. 

                                        Available treatments for the management of Tinnitus are diverse. Highest evidence for clinical efficacy is available for cognitive-Behavioral therapies. Further established treatment includes counselling and various forms of sound therapy along with methods that attempt to increase input to the auditory system, such as hearing aids and masking of Tinnitus, Sedation and Tranquilizers.Despite its prevalence and effect on quality of life there is no evidence based guideline about management of Tinnitus till today and hence poses a challenge for finding such drugs or therapies in alternate systems of medicine.Ayurveda has a systematic line of treatment in the management of Karnanada. The Line of treatment in Ayurveda for four diseases viz. Karnashoola, Pranada, Karnashweda and Badhirya is similar. The General line of Treatment for Karnarogas is Ghritapana , Rasayana, Avyayama, Ashirasnana, Brahmacharya, AkathanaKarna is one of the Adhisthana of Vata Dosha..In Ayurveda since vata is the main dosha involved in karnanada disease. The treatment should be aimed at Vatashamana and Rasayana Karnapooran is an important therapy in karnarogas.It has unique quality of getting absorbed easily by the pores in the skin and there by act to supply the nutrition to nerves.Hence in present study, Karanpoorna with Nirgundyadi Tail and Hingvadi Tail possessing vatahara property is selected for the study. Ghrita is having“Sanskarasya  Anuvartanatva so Ashwagandha Ghrita is selected for internal administration having Rasayana,Balya and Vatahara properties which can prevent age related degenerative changes in the inner ear.Hence it is proposed to undertake this study entitled "A Randomized Comparative Clinical Study to Evaluate the Effect of Nirgundyadi Tail Karnapoorna and Hingvadi Tail Karnapoorna along with Ashwagandha Ghrita Orally in Karnanada(Tinnitus)"
